India’s communist leader Sitaram Yechury passes away due to pneumonia



NEW DELHI: Communist Party of India (Marxist) General Secretary Sitaram Yechury passed away on Thursday due to pneumonia.

Yechury was admitted to the AIIMS in Delhi on August 19, 2024.

He had been first admitted to the emergency ward and then shifted to the Intensive Care Unit (ICU).

“Sitaram Yechury CPI(M) General Secretary no more. He was admitted in AIIMS,” CPI (M) leader Hannan Mollah told ANI.

Sitaram Yechury was a prominent Indian politician who held a seat in the CPM politburo for 32 years and served as the party’s General Secretary from 2015.

Additionally, he represented West Bengal in the Rajya Sabha, the upper house of the Indian parliament, from 2005 to 2017.
